MIT Starts Supply Chain Management Degree Program

On Wednesday, MIT, announced away its pilot project. It gives a chance to the students to pay about $1500 for the exams, and once they do it they will be facilitated withMicroMaster’s credential.

MicroMaster’scredential, is the supply chain management program.

The second semester students are required to pay up $33,000

Anyone who wants to be here now has a shot to be here. They have a chance to prove in advance that they can do the work. – L. Rafael Reif, MIT President
